A solo participant on the Bitcoin network has managed to pull off a result that doesn’t happen often at all. According to a post shared by Bitcoin Archive here, a small-scale miner successfully mined a full block and walked away with 3.139 BTC in rewards, worth about $210,000 at the time. Vitalik Buterin is taking a very different approach to AI, and it’s already sparking conversations across both crypto and tech circles. In a recent update shared here, Buterin revealed that he has completely stopped using cloud-based AI services. Instead, he now runs everything locally on his own machine.
